At what part does suspect become classified as a defendant?
stepan [7]

Answer:

Under the judicial systems of the U.S., once a decision is approved to arrest a suspect, or bind him over for trial, either by a prosecutor issuing an information, a grand jury issuing a true bill or indictment, or a judge issuing an arrest warrant, the suspect can then be properly called a defendant, or the accused.

The Framers of the Constitution originally left voter rights and suffrage up to
IrinaK [193]

Answer:

The United States Constitution did not originally define who was eligible to vote, allowing each state to determine who was eligible.
